Posted: Sat Jul 27, 2013 6:15 pm Post subject: Activating voicemail stops incoming calls |
|
|
Just got my device today. Outgoing calls are clear and consistent. Cool.
My first problem was that ALL incoming calls were being routed to voice mail. Online support sent me the latest install file and, after running it, the problem was fixed. Incoming calls were also clear. Feeling good so far.
But as soon as I activated voice mail all incoming calls got sent directly to voice mail. The phone never rang. I've even set the wait period to 1 minute, but the calls immediately get forwarded to VM.
The only way I can undo this is to turn off voice mail then reinstall the software. If I then don't touch the voice mail setting, I can make and receive calls.
I've done this now 3 times and it's always the same results. I'm liking the device so far, but I would really like to be able to use the voice mail feature without losing the ability to answer calls myself.
Any suggestions would be most appreciated.

Update
=====
After switching the settings back and forth for a while. I managed to get the voice mail feature to work without directly sending the calls to vm (i.e., allowing the phone to ring first).
It would appear that changing all the voice mail settings to their desired values first, then reinstalling the software, is what ultimately did the trick.
I leave this in case anyone else runs into a similar situation.
